Surface Plasmon Polaritons and Visible Light Coupling via Photorefractive Phase Gratings in Indium Tin Oxide Coated Iron-doped LiNbO3 Crystal Slabs

Abstract

2D diffraction patterns without external feedback, 89% total reflectivity, visible reconfigurable waveguides formed on the slab of ITO coated iron-doped LiNbO3 hinted that photorefractive phase gratings are responsible for the excitation of SPPs and strong coupling with light beams.
